Outdoor Bluetooth Speakers Durability and Waterproof Ratings

img-1.jpg

When you're out and about, you need speakers that keep playing no matter if it rains or there's dust around. Knowing the waterproof and durability ratings helps you pick a speaker that matches your outdoor lifestyle.

  • IPX5: Can handle water jets, which makes it good for light rain or splashes.
  • IPX6: Stands up to heavier water sprays, so it’s better for more intense conditions.
  • IPX7: Survives being dipped in water up to one meter deep for 30 minutes. Great by the pool, but not for long underwater sessions.
  • Dust Protection: Helps keep fine particles out, so your speaker stays clean and works well.

For extra protection, we suggest placing your speaker under eaves or another shelter during storms. If you're wiring a fixed setup, use wiring rated for outdoor use and run it in a conduit to protect against weather changes. After a day by the pool or at the beach, take a moment to check the seals and gently wipe away any salt or chlorine. This kind of care keeps your rugged speaker ready for your next outing.

Outdoor Bluetooth Speakers Battery Performance and Power Options

Most outdoor Bluetooth speakers run for 10 to 20 hours at a moderate volume. For example, the Sony SRS-XB100 lasts up to 16 hours, while the Anker Soundcore Boom 2 can hit around 24 hours. This range means you can easily pick a speaker that suits your plan, whether it's a short outing or a full-day adventure.

Newer models now come with USB-C fast charging, so a quick 20- to 30-minute charge can give you several extra hours of playtime. This smart feature lets you enjoy your outdoor tunes more and worry less about running out of battery.

Premium options like the Sonos Move 2 push things further by mixing in Wi-Fi to extend standby time between charges. Some even support accessory solar panels, tapping into renewable energy when you can't plug in. This makes them a great pick for long trips when you want a reliable, eco-friendly audio companion.

Outdoor Bluetooth Speakers: Top Models Reviewed and Pricing

If you're looking for a reliable outdoor Bluetooth speaker, there are plenty of great options at different price points. We’ve gathered some real-world favorites that stand out in design, battery life, and extra features.

Sony SRS-XB100 ($53) is a compact speaker that lasts up to 16 hours. It’s perfect for travel or a small backyard get-together. Its size makes it easy to pack up and carry wherever you go.

The Anker Soundcore Motion 300 ($67.99) adds more tech to the mix. It supports AAC and LDAC, meaning you get crisp, high-quality sound even over Bluetooth. Plus, it carries an IPX7 water resistance rating, so a little rain won’t ruin your fun.

Beats Pill (2024) comes in at $99.95. With a dustproof build and USB-C charging, it’s built to handle everyday use and syncs easily with Apple devices for added convenience.

JBL Flip 6 ($89.95) is another strong contender. It features a weatherproof design coupled with rich, punchy low-end sound that really gets the party started outdoors.

At $109, the Bose SoundLink Micro is built to be tough while delivering clear, crisp audio. Its 12-hour battery ensures you can keep the tunes playing throughout your day.

For those who want a bit more power, the Anker Boom 2 ($94.99) offers an 80 W output. You can even fine-tune your listening experience with customizable EQ settings via its companion app, making it a great choice for lively backyard parties.

If style and extra controls are your thing, the Marshall Middleton II ($329.99) brings a guitar amp-inspired look along with separate bass and treble adjustments. It even includes a charging port so you can power up other devices on the go.

For high-end audio and versatile performance at large outdoor events, Sony ULT Field 7 ($398) packs a mighty bass, LED effects, and multiple input options like a guitar or mic. And close on its heels is the Sonos Move 2 ($399), which offers dual tweeters and smart connectivity with Wi-Fi and Alexa. This premium option is ideal when you need dynamic sound for energetic gatherings.

Outdoor Bluetooth Speakers Maintenance and Longevity Tips

Keeping your outdoor Bluetooth speakers in tip-top shape is easier than you might think. After a day by the pool or a backyard party, simply wipe them down with a soft, damp cloth to remove any salt or chlorine. When you're not using your speakers, store them somewhere sheltered. This prevents long exposure to sun, wind, or rain that can damage rubber seals and other weatherproof parts. Always check the manufacturer’s cleaning guidelines to make sure you're doing it right.

For speakers that are permanently installed, consider proper setup to ensure lasting performance. Run your speaker wiring through burial-rated conduit to keep cables safe from the elements. Positioning your speakers under eaves or in a covered area also helps reduce direct weather exposure. These small steps go a long way to keeping your climate-resistant audio system performing well season after season.
